Zip Code Overview

As of 2007, Athens (zip 30605)'s population is 42,977 people. Since 2000, it has had a population growth of 10.28 percent.

The median home cost in Athens (zip 30605) is $180,000. Home appreciation the last year has been -2.65 percent.

Compared to the rest of the country, Athens (zip 30605)'s cost of living is 15.57% Lower than the U.S. average.

Athens (zip 30605) public schools spend $6,029 per student. The average school expenditure in the U.S. is $6,058. There are about 14 students per teacher in Athens (zip 30605).

The unemployment rate in Athens (zip 30605) is 3.60 percent(U.S. avg. is 4.60%). Recent job growth is Positive. Athens (zip 30605) jobs have Increased by 3.42 percent.

Crime

Athens (zip 30605), GA, violent crime, on a scale from 1 (low crime) to 10, is 5. Violent crime is composed of four offenses: murder and nonnegligent manslaughter, forcible rape, robbery, and aggravated assault. The US average is 3.

Athens (zip 30605), GA, property crime, on a scale from 1 (low) to 10, is 6. Property crime includes the offenses of burglary, larceny-theft, motor vehicle theft, and arson. The object of the theft-type offenses is the taking of money or property, but there is no force or threat of force against the victims. The US average is 3.

Climate

Athens (zip 30605), GA, gets 49 inches of rain per year. The US average is 37. Snowfall is 1 inches. The average US city gets 25 inches of snow per year. The number of days with any measurable precipitation is 98.

On average, there are 218 sunny days per year in Athens (zip 30605), GA. The July high is around 91 degrees. The January low is 33. Our comfort index, which is based on humidity during the hot months, is a 31 out of 100, where higher is more comfortable. The US average on the comfort index is 44.
